** The Volvo repair market for Hosston residents is centralized in Shreveport. The market is characterized by a clear dichotomy between the authorized dealership and high-quality independent specialists. * **Average Quality:** The quality of service is high, with multiple shops possessing the specific expertise required for modern Volvos. Customers are not limited to a single option. * **Competition Level:** Competition is healthy but specialized. The dealership (Landers) holds a monopoly on factory-certified services and software, while independents like Parnell Jones and German Auto Performance compete on price, customer service, and deep mechanical expertise. There is no "generic" repair shop that can be recommended for complex Volvo systems. * **Typical Pricing:** Pricing follows a standard tiered structure for European vehicles. The dealership commands the highest labor rates, reflecting their factory training and facility overhead. The independent specialists offer more competitive labor rates, typically 15-30% lower, while still using high-quality parts. For all providers, parts costs are inherently higher than for domestic vehicles. A complex diagnosis or transmission repair can easily run into the $1,500 - $4,000+ range.
